Urban Cleaning Professionals: Invisible, But Essential

Every day, the city of São Paulo collects approximately 12,000 tons of household waste, totaling about 360,000 tons monthly.

Behind these impressive numbers are the street sweepers and other urban cleaning professionals, essential workers for the maintenance of public health and collective well-being.

The work of street sweepers goes far beyond simple garbage collection. These professionals ensure the cleanliness and conservation of public spaces, removing waste that, if accumulated, could cause clogged drains, floods, and sanitary problems.

With their brooms and collection equipment, they sweep streets, sidewalks, and other public areas, eliminating everything from improperly discarded items to organic waste and dry leaves.

To perform this function, the requirements include motivation and dedication, a sense of community, good physical condition, and the ability to work as a team.

Although often undervalued, the profession of street sweeper is fundamental to urban quality of life and deserves proper recognition.

Urban Mobility: The Pulse Of The City

Public transportation is another vital sector for the functioning of São Paulo. Bus drivers are responsible for connecting various points in the city, allowing the daily movement of millions of workers.

These professionals face considerable challenges, from intense urban traffic to the responsibility of safely transporting large numbers of passengers.

Job openings for public transport drivers in São Paulo require, in addition to specific qualifications (categories D or E), the ability to make daily trips along pre-established routes, respond to requests for passenger boarding and alighting, and regularly check the vehicle’s condition, including tires, doors, brakes, and water and oil levels.

In addition to drivers, train operators also play a crucial role in Paulist mobility, ensuring the operation of one of the busiest metro systems in the world.

Leak Detection In São Bernardo Do Campo: Technology At The Service Of The Economy

In São Bernardo do Campo, a municipality neighboring the capital, leak detection services have gained prominence due to their economic and environmental importance.

Companies use cutting-edge technology to detect hidden leaks in underground pipes or within walls.

Hidden leaks can be very difficult to detect visually, occurring in underground pipes or inside structures, causing constant water loss and reflecting on monthly bills.

In addition to water waste, these problems can cause serious structural damage to properties if not corrected quickly.

There are companies that offer hydraulic leak detection services in São Bernardo do Campo for prices starting at R$149, using modern techniques such as geophones, which precisely locate the origin of leaks through specific sounds emitted by escaping water.

Others provide not only leak location services but also detailed technical reports that can be presented to the sanitation company, potentially allowing reductions of up to 50% in the charges during the period the leak was active.

Among the technologies used are detection via hydrophone (for underwater leaks), geophone (for hidden leaks detected acoustically), pressurization tests, pointer tests, and the use of chemical tracers.

Professions On The Rise In The Capital

LinkedIn recently released a list of the 10 job positions that have grown the most in the capital in recent years. Among the highlighted positions are special education teachers, travel agents, and medical secretaries.

Special education teachers, who lead the ranking, are responsible for helping students with learning difficulties and different disabilities, adapting lessons to meet individual needs.

Travel agents, in second place, plan itineraries and make travel arrangements for individuals, groups, or companies.

In third place are medical secretaries, who perform administrative tasks in healthcare settings, such as scheduling appointments and managing patient records.

An interesting fact is the gender division in these hires. Among special education teachers, 76.19% of contracted professionals in 2024 are women, while among travel agents this percentage is 68.32%, and among medical secretaries it reaches 86.67%.

Sweeping And Public Cleaning Professionals

The Executive Secretariat of Urban Cleaning (SELIMP) in São Paulo is responsible for another crucial service for the city: manual sweeping of public roads and areas.

The teams sweep streets, sidewalks, and squares, collecting trash and debris, contributing to a cleaner and healthier environment.

In addition to sweeping, SELIMP maintains street bins (public trash cans) strategically distributed in high-traffic public areas, such as near metro stations, bus terminals, schools, hospitals, and shopping centers.

Voluntary Delivery Points (PEVs) are also available, closed containers where citizens can deposit recyclable materials for later processing.
